Automation and Machine Design Engineer Role:

The Automation and Machine Design Engineer role exists to take complete ownership of custom machinery projects from initial design concepts through manufacturing, testing, and final customer acceptance. Rather than just acting as a desk-bound drafter, this position acts as the sole driver of the engineering process, developing complete, practical manufacturing solutions to unique mechanical challenges.

Automation and Machine Design Engineer Responsibilities:

  • Design custom automated deburring, finishing, inspection, and material handling equipment using SolidWorks or similar 3D CAD software
  • Develop complete machine assemblies including structural weldments, machine bases, guarding, tooling, workholding, conveyors, brush systems, and custom mechanical mechanisms
  • Select, specify, and integrate commercially available components such as linear rails, bearings, motion systems, power transmission, motors, gearboxes, and pneumatic/hydraulic components
  • Collaborate daily with controls engineers, machinists, welders, fabrication personnel, and assembly technicians throughout every project phase
  • Visit the production floor proactively to support machine assembly, troubleshoot mechanical/motion issues, and verify fit and function as equipment comes together
  • Modify and refine machine designs based on real-world feedback and unforeseen manufacturing, assembly, or application challenges
  • Communicate directly with customers and suppliers to understand applications, discuss design concepts, provide project updates, and resolve technical issues
  • Participate in customer design reviews, project meetings, and Factory Acceptance Testing (FAT)
  • Create and maintain comprehensive engineering documentation including assembly drawings, bills of material (BOMs), spare parts lists, and technical documentation for manuals
  • Manage project design hours and material cost targets developed during the quotation process to ensure projects stay within budget goals
  • Structure the design process, bills of material, drawing packages, and the release process from engineering to manufacturing autonomously
